Today’s featured Chinese idiom is 「剛正不阿」, and its meaning and usage are explained below.
A: to cater to, to favor. Be strong and upright, do not flatter, and be impartial.
The Mandarin pronunciation of this idiom is :
gāng zhèng bù ā
while its Cantonese pinyin is :
gong1 jeng3/jing3 bat1 a3
